  15. minnesotaart

    2013~2016 CX-5 Belt Tensioner - Shouldn't this be a warranty item?

    Yup! Lack of access made it impossible to guide the belt as needed for the zip tie method. And the shape of the water pump pully along with the tight clearance would not allow use of the tool shown. The water pump pulley is in a really sucky place on the 2.5L, the 2.0L seems to have better access.
